Output c783dd8240dc59aaa447b452fb4c24d651bf3faa082a3cc84e36d497e54ef21f:6

value
26221659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99fa0f82d5940aeffb104056edc040f985ec32d OP_EQUAL
address
MSHFHC1d68BfZ2rixZWv1SeFXF9Q2JPLBD
transaction
c783dd8240dc59aaa447b452fb4c24d651bf3faa082a3cc84e36d497e54ef21f
spent
true